Emily bicycles her way to school everyday. If the equation 𝑑(𝑡)=2.5𝑡 represents the distance in meters in t seconds, then how far is she from her home after 150 seconds?
Solution
To find out how far Emily is from her home after 150 seconds, we need to substitute t = 150 into the equation d(t) = 2.5t.
Step 1: Substitute t = 150 into the equation d(150) = 2.5 * 150
Step 2: Multiply 2.5 by 150 d(150) = 375
So, Emily is 375 meters away from her home after 150 seconds.
